While category management follows a similar structure no matter where you would apply it, a specialty shop will follow different protocols compared to a whole foods seller.
For instance, for whole foods which cater mostly to families, it might be categorized by its basic flavor, color and matching foods. For specialty stores, which can expect more knowledgeable customers, bouquet, age, and exclusivity might play a role.
Specialty stores will also routinely carry a selection of "special orders" which are not available in most whole foods stores.
